Meridon, the desolate Romany girl, is determined to escape the hard poverty of her childhood: Riding bareback in a travelling show, while her sister Dandy risks her life on the trapeze, Meridon dedicates herself to freeing them both from danger and want.But Dandy - beautiful, impatient, thieving Dandy - grabs too much, too quickly. And Merdion finds herself alone, riding in bitter grief through the rich Sussex farmlands towards a house called Wideacre - which awaits the return of the last of the Laceys.Sweeping, passionate, unique: Meridon completes Philippa Gregory's bestselling trilogy which began with Wideacre and continued in The Favoured Child
